Background of Rouge Park

– Rouge Park is currently the largest near-urban park in North America, at over 47 square kilometers. Located in York and Durham Regions and City of Toronto from Lake Ontario to 16th Avenue, it has 6 developed trails with guided hikes 7 times a week by certified hike leaders.

– The park has a rich diversity of natural and cultural heritage resources, including: a rare Carolinian forest; numerous species at risk; a national historic site; geological outcrops from the inter-glacial age that are internationally significant; and, with evidence of human history dating back over 10,000 years, including some of Canada’s oldest known Aboriginal historic sites and villages.
